Zusammenfassung

Gut wirkende Wasserstrahlpumpen waren früher mehr oder weniger Zufallsprodukte. Um die Herstellung auf eine rationelle Grundlage zu stellen, wurden die günstigsten Bedingungen theoretisch und experimentell festgelegt [81].
